What is the Volume of the Cylinder?
The formula for volume of a cylinder is:
V = πr²h
Where:
r is radius
h is height
Volume of the cylinder that is left will be:
V_left = π(15² * 10) - π(11² * 10)
V_left = 3266 cubic inches .
